14/*
15 * for non-zero x
16 * x = ieee_frexp(arg,&exp);
17 * return a double fp quantity x such that 0.5 <= |x| <1.0
18 * and the corresponding binary exponent "exp". That is
19 * arg = x*2^exp.
20 * If arg is inf, 0.0, or NaN, then ieee_frexp(arg,&exp) returns arg
21 * with *exp=0.
22 */
